25 | .SH NAME | |
26 | gstack \- print a stack trace of a running process | |
27 | ||
28 | .SH SYNOPSIS | |
29 | .B gstack | |
30 | pid | |
31 | ||
32 | .SH DESCRIPTION | |
33 | ||
34 | \f3gstack\f1 attaches to the active process named by the \f3pid\f1 on | |
35 | the command line, and prints out an execution stack trace. If ELF | |
36 | symbols exist in the binary (usually the case unless you have run | |
37 | strip(1)), then symbolic addresses are printed as well. | |
38 | ||
39 | If the process is part of a thread group, then \f3gstack\f1 will print | |
40 | out a stack trace for each of the threads in the group. | |
